Grandon recorded 64.5 tackles (46 solo), 21.5 TFLs, 9.5 sacks, and 3 forced fumbles in 2025. While certainly undersized as a DE, he certainly doesn't look like it on tape, showcasing an impressive amount of length and burst off the snap, being able to beat Tackles consistently to the outside shoulder to get around them and into the pocket. Booth recorded 27 tackles, 10 TFLs, and 5 sacks in 2025. Booth flashes a variety of pass-rush moves while flashing raw power, being able to drive defenders back with a simple bull-rush, which he showed particularly in the interior, being able to gain traction against much bigger interior-linemen. A bit more bulk to his frame could make his versatile play-style much more suitable at the collegiate level. Kalainoff built upon an impressive freshman campaign, recording 31 tackles (17 solo), 9.5 TFLs, 4 sacks, and 2 forced fumbles in 2025. Kalainoff is certainly an unpolished product in the makings, but with exceptional length and hands, he was able to gain leverage on blockers easily while being able to nab the ball-carriers as they are passing by to stop them from advancing through an open hole. Kalainoff showcased solid fundamental, pass-rush moves, and a consistent motor already through 2 seasons. Feuerbach recorded 53 tackles, 12 TFLs, 4 sacks, and 2 fumble recoveries in 2025. Despite his status as an interior-defensive lineman, his relentless and tenacious attitude on the line has helped him dominate the A and B gaps, being able to collapse the pocket from within and force the QB to scramble outside while also having the speed to chase down the QB running outside the perimeter. Thomsen recorded 39 tackles (23 solo), 12.5 TFLs, 5.5 sacks, 1 FF, 3 fumble recoveries, and 1 defensive TD last season. Thomsen was quite exciting to watch last season, proving so explosive and fast off the snap, being able to consistently break into the backfield in little time and swing the QB down, proving aggressive and very effective. Eckerman recorded 37.5 tackles (25 solo), 9 TFLs, 4.5 sacks, and 2 forced fumbles in 2025. A disruptive pass-rusher who cannot be left unblocked, Eckerman was consistently able to find his way into the pocket last season, and his quickness gives QBs little time to react, but he's proven potent as a natural DE winning 1-on-1 against OTs as well, with quick agility and a strong swim move to be able to get around blockers as well as change direction to adjust to where the ball-carrier is going. Prochaska recorded 10 tackles, 7 TFLs, 5 sacks, a forced fumble, and a fumble recovery last season. Flashing impressive athleticism for his age, Prochaska holds some gaudy testing numbers, including a 36.1" vertical jump, a 255 lb max bench, and a 365 lb max squat. On the field, Prochaska is able to attack downhill very effectively, showing a flexible bend on the Edge, while also possessing the length to gain leverage against blockers on the outside as well as to bat down passes at the LOS. Alexander recorded 78.5 tackles (53 solo), 23 TFLs, 6 sacks, a forced fumble, and a fumble recovery last season. Alexander is a bit of an unconventional LB prospect; one who isn't afraid of creeping the line and blitzing on nearly every down, and he's very effective in this role, being able to constantly break through the line and create pressure in the backfield.
